COVID-19 Update: USCIS to Continue to Process EAD Extension Requests Despite Application Support Center Closures

According to USCIS announcement dated March 30, 2020, USCIS will continue to process EAD (employment authorization)  extension requests despite application support center closures and will reuse previously submitted bio-metrics in order to process valid Form I-765, Application for Employment Authorization, extension requests due to the temporary closure of Application Support Centers (ASC) to the public in response to the Coronavirus (COVID-19) pandemic. This announcement is consistent with existing USCIS authorities regarding the agency’s ability to reuse previously submitted bio-metrics.

Applicants who had an appointment scheduled with an ASC on or after the March 18 closure or has filed an I-765 extension will have their application processed using previously submitted bio-metrics.  This will remain in effect until ASCs are open for appointments to the public.
